   Click up a terminal in your user account/login, run the command "id".   
      
   Do you see the dialout group in the list? If not, you have to get to   
   the group dialout, and add daniel, log out/in as daniel and run the id   
   command again. I would expect you to see something like, but not exactly:   
      
   $ id   
   uid=500(daniel) gid=500(daniel) groups=500(daniel),83(dialout)   
      
   83 is the number on Mageia 3, no telling what is on your install.
